Why Choose a Three-Wheeled Electric Scooter?

The primary advantage of a three-wheeled electric scooter is its increased stability. The wider base and extra wheel significantly reduce the risk of tipping over, particularly beneficial on uneven surfaces or when carrying cargo. This enhanced stability translates to a more confident and comfortable riding experience, making them ideal for commuters and recreational riders alike. Furthermore, many models offer features designed specifically to enhance safety, such as improved braking systems and brighter lights.

What are the Different Types of Three-Wheeled Electric Scooters?

Three-wheeled electric scooters for adults come in various designs, catering to different needs and preferences. The most common types include:

  • Two wheels in the front, one in the back: This configuration provides excellent stability and maneuverability, making it a popular choice for city riding. The larger front wheels often handle bumps and uneven pavements more effectively.

  • One wheel in the front, two in the back: This configuration provides exceptional stability, making it ideal for carrying heavier loads or for riders who prioritize safety above all else. It might feel slightly less agile than the two-in-front, one-in-back design, however.

Are Three-Wheel Electric Scooters Safe?

While no scooter is entirely risk-free, three-wheeled models generally offer a higher degree of safety compared to two-wheeled scooters. The wider base significantly reduces the chance of tipping over, especially during sudden stops or on uneven terrain. However, it’s crucial to always wear a helmet and follow local traffic laws. Always check the scooter's brakes and tires before each ride to ensure optimal safety.

What are the Best Features to Look for in a Three-Wheeled Electric Scooter for Adults?

When choosing a three-wheeled electric scooter, several key features should be considered:

  • Motor Power: Consider the wattage of the motor. A higher wattage generally translates to better hill-climbing ability and a faster top speed.

  • Battery Range: The battery's capacity determines how far you can travel on a single charge. Consider your daily commute or typical riding distance when selecting a scooter.

  •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ter's weight capacity comfortably accommodates your weight and any additional cargo you might carry.

  • Suspension: Suspension systems can significantly improve the ride comfort, especially on rough terrain. Look for scooters with front and/or rear suspension for a smoother ride.

  • Braking System: A reliable braking system is crucial for safety. Consider scooters with both front and rear brakes, preferably regenerative braking for extended battery life.

  • Tires: Pneumatic tires offer better shock absorption than solid tires, providing a more comfortable ride on uneven surfaces.

  • Display: A clear and informative display is essential for monitoring speed, battery level, and other essential information.

How Long Does the Battery Last?

Battery life varies greatly depending on factors like scooter model, riding style, terrain, and battery health. However, most three-wheeled electric scooters offer a range of at least 15-25 miles on a single charge, with some high-end models exceeding 40 miles. Always consult the manufacturer's specifications for accurate range estimates.
